$70,000.00/yr - $75,000.00/yr Additional compensation types
Annual Bonus Direct message the job poster from EverLine - Energy's Technical Stack Responsibilities
Monitor network performance and alert senior staff of any issues requiring attention on a daily basis Maintain network documentation accuracy and remove obsolete configurations Provide first-level technical support and troubleshooting for network-related problems on an L1 level Support senior engineers with project implementation and testing Configure switches, routers, and other network devices under supervision of EverLines Sr. Network Engineers Implement and verify security policies on next-generation firewall systems Maintain accurate network diagrams and technical documentation Qualifications
Basic understanding of network protocols and network security principles Familiarity with routers, switches, firewalls, and other network hardware (hands-on experience preferred but not required) Strong problem-solving abilities and willingness to learn Good communication skills both written and verbal Ability to work independently and in a team setting Detail-oriented approach to documentation and configuration management Eagerness to learn new technologies and networking concepts High school diploma or equivalent required 6 months to 2 years of experience in IT support, help desk, or related technical field Basic knowledge of networking concepts (TCP/IP, DHCP, DNS, VLANs) Familiarity with Windows and Linux operating systems Basic troubleshooting skills for hardware and software issues Ability to lift up to 50 pounds for equipment installation Valid drivers license and reliable transportation Willingness to participate in on-call rotation after training period Desired but not Required
Associate or Bachelors degree in Cybersecurity, Information Technology, Computer Science, Network Administration, or related field Industry certifications such as CompTIA Network+, Security+, or Cisco CCNA Previous experience with network monitoring tools Knowledge of industrial control systems or OT environments Experience with ticketing systems and IT service management tools Basic scripting knowledge (PowerShell, Python, or Bash) The employee will work predominantly in an office environment, utilizing standard office and computing equipment. Standard work hours with an on-call rotation. EverLine adheres to a hybrid work policy of 2 days a week onsite. If working remotely, the employee will be required to support video teleconferencing when applicable, as well as attend teleconference meetings originating in other time zones, which may occur outside normal working hours. The employee will interface with remote employees, requiring reliance on email and phone communications, as well as ability to maintain productivity while working autonomously.
